Skateboarder Struck by Car in Pacific Beach

The man crossed Felspar Street against the traffic signal when he was hit by a driver

A 22-year-old man was critically injured Monday night when he rode his skateboard across a crosswalk against a traffic warning and was hit by a car, police said.

The San Diego Police Department (SDPD) said the skateboarder was riding southbound on the west sidewalk of Ingraham Street in Pacific Beach just after 9 p.m. when he crossed Felspar Street against a “Don’t Walk” signal. He was struck by a driver in a Prius as she made a left turn onto the street.

Police said the man on the skateboard suffered a severe head injury. He’s not expected to survive. The driver was not injured in the accident.

No further details were released.
